What You're Getting

This is not a basic fitness band. The CZ Smart PQ2 runs Wear OS by Google, works with both iPhone and Android, and packs a Qualcomm 4100+ chipset. The headline feature is the proprietary YouQ wellness app, built with input from NASA Ames Center research and IBM Watson AI. It tracks your Chronotype, computes HR, SP02, sleep, and alertness scores, then delivers a 24-hour forecast of your energy levels. The Alert Monitor uses a gamified version of NASA's PVT+ test to measure cognitive fatigue. Power Fixes suggest napuccino breaks or other interventions when your energy flags.

Battery life hits 24-plus hours and recharges fully in 40 minutes. Sensors include gyroscope, altimeter, barometer, accelerometer, heart rate, SP02, and ambient light.

GPS, Bluetooth, Wi-Fi, and NFC are all onboard. Amazon Alexa is built in, and you get access to Google Fit, Strava, Spotify, and YouTube Music through the Play Store.

The Caveat

Battery life varies with usage. Heavy GPS and always-on display use will push you toward daily charging. The 41mm case runs smaller than many sport smartwatches, so check sizing if you prefer a larger face.
